There are currently five candidates registered to contest the seat of Page. They are:
This is half of the ten candidates that ran in the 2022 Federal Election campaign in Page. Missing is the One Nation Party, Liberal Democratic Party, Australian Federation Party, Indigenous Party of Australia, United Australia Party, The New Liberals and any Independents.
Family First and Australian Citizens Party did not run a candidate in 2022.
Pre-poll voting will begin on Tuesday, April 22, after Easter. We will be adding a Pre-poll Voting button as the date gets closer.
We will also be adding a Where to Vote button for those who like to vote on election day itself, Saturday, May 3.
